Last Rites
Release: January 01, 1988

A New York priest with blood ties to the Mafia uses the auspices of the Church to protect the mistress of a murdered Mafia Don--who is being hunted by hitmen in the employ of her lover's widow.

An unhandled error has occurred. Reload Dismiss